Her Expo Promotes Local Businesswomen

By: Kristin Anderson
Updated: June 30, 2012
Today was the first day of the Her Expo, which invited women who own businesses to come together to meet each other and create contacts. Various businesses were present, along with some wine tasting and live music. But the main purpose of the expo was to get the names of these businesses out for the Abilene community.

"A lot of these businesses don't have store fronts. So they don't have a lot of ways to connect with people. And it's just a way to get out there and to let Abilene know what businesses we have out there that don't have your typical store front," said Kim Harris, co-host of the expo.

There was also a diaper drive at the event, and all diapers collected went to the local diaper bank.
